Abstract

A device for removing dirt and contaminants from a surface comprises a number of fibres (24) fixedly supported at one end and extending towards and engaging at a contact surface (28) the surface (2) from which the dirt and contaminants shall be removed. The fibres (24) have conveyor surfaces (32) extending obliquely in relation to the direction of relative movement between the fibres and said surface (2), said conveyor surfaces being adapted to move the dirt and contaminants away from said surface in direction transversely to the direction to said relative movement between the fibres (24) and said surface (2).
